A Journey Through Time
As the boat set off, the city unfolded before me like a living history book. We glided past the majestic Houses of Parliament, their gothic spires reaching for the sky, and the timeless chime of Big Ben resonating across the water. The London Eye loomed large, a modern marvel juxtaposed against the historic skyline.
Passing under the Millennium Bridge, I couldn’t help but recall its cinematic appearance in the Harry Potter films. The sleek design led my gaze directly to the dome of St. Paul’s Cathedral, a masterpiece of resilience and grace. Each landmark told a story, from the ancient Tower of London, with its tales of royal intrigue, to the futuristic elegance of The Shard piercing the sky.
